+ - Note: The remainder of the instructions assume you picked iwd here.
|
|
|
+ - Preparations:
|
|
|
+ 1. Make sure a driver is loaded for the WLAN device:
|
|
|
+ - `ip a` should show a `wlp*` interface for the device.
|
|
|
+ - `lspci -k` (for PCIe) or `lsusb -v` (for USB) should show a loaded module.
|
|
|
+ 1. Make sure the radio device isn't blocked: `rfkill` (should show "unblocked")
|
|
|
+ 1. Create the `netdev` group to allow users to control iwd/wpa_supplicant: `groupadd -r netdev`
|
|
|
+ - Using iwd (recommended):
|
|
|
+ 1. Install: `pacman -S iwd`
|
|
|
+ 1. Configure: See example config below for config `/etc/iwd/main.conf`.
|
|
|
+ 1. Enable: `systemctl enable --now iwd.service`
|
|
|
+ - If this fails, you may need to reboot.
|
|
|
+ 1. Setup the network config:
|
|
|
+ 1. Create a systemd-network config similar to the one for the wired interface, but add `IgnoreCarrierLoss=5s` to the `Network` section to allow for roaming without disconnects.
|
|
|
+ 1. Restart systemd-networkd.
|
|
|
+ 1. (Example) Connect to WPA2/WPA3 personal network (using `iwctl`):
|
|
|
+ 1. (Note) `iwctl` has extenside tab-complete support.
|
|
|
+ 1. Enter `iwctl`: `iwctl`
|
|
|
+ 1. Show devices: `device list`
|
|
|
+ 1. Show device info: `device <device> show`
|
|
|
+ 1. Scan for networks: `station <device> scan`
|
|
|
+ 1. Show networks: `station <device> get-networks`
|
|
|
+ 1. Connect to network: `station <device> connect <SSID>`
|
|
|
+ 1. Show connection info: `station <device> show`
|
|
|
+ 1. Disconnect from the network: `station <device> disconnect`
|
|
|
+ 1. Show known networks: `known-networks list`
|
|
|
+ 1. Forget known network: `known-networks <SSID> forget`
|
|
|
+ 1. (Example) Connect to eduroam:
|
|
|
+ 1. (Note) See the [wiki](https://wiki.archlinux.org/title/Iwd#eduroam) for more info.
|
|
|
+ 1. Go to the [eduroam configuration assistant tool (CAT)](https://cat.eduroam.org/) to download a config script for your organization. **Don't run it**, it doesn't support `iwd`.
|
|
|
+ 1. Create the private credentials dir: `mkdir /var/lib/iwd/ && chown root:root /var/lib/iwd/ && chmod 700 /var/lib/iwd/`
|
|
|
+ 1. Create the config file `/var/lib/iwd/eduroam.8021x` (name-sensitive), containing the template snippet below with values found in the eduroam script.

+ - Using wpa_supplicant (not recommended):
|
|
|
+ 1. Install: `sudo pacman -S wpa_supplicant`
|
|
|
+ 1. Configure:
|
|
|
+ - See example config below for config `/etc/wpa_supplicant/wpa_supplicant.conf`.
|
|
|
+ - Fix the permissions (it contains secrets): `sudo chmod 600 /etc/wpa_supplicant/wpa_supplicant.conf`
|
|
|
+ - Create a place to put certs and protect it: `sudo mkdir -p /var/lib/wpa_supplicant/certs; sudo chmod 700 /var/lib/wpa_supplicant`
|
|
|
+ - Using `update_config` allows it to update its config, which may change file permissions to something "readable by everyone", according to the Arch wiki. If you don't need this, set it to 0.
|
|
|
+ - Set `country` to your country code.
|
|
|
+ 1. (Optional) Test the daemon and config:
|
|
|
+ 1. Start it in debug mode: `sudo wpa_supplicant -B -i <interface> -c /etc/wpa_supplicant/wpa_supplicant.conf -d`
|
|
|
+ 1. See if you successfully connect by running and watching `sudo wpa_cli`.
|
|
|
+ 1. (Optional) Check that you can see all networks:
|
|
|
+ 1. `sudo wpa_cli scan`
|
|
|
+ 1. `sudo wpa_cli scan_results`
|
|
|
+ 1. Kill it: `sudo pkill wpa_supplicant`
